Verdict
Dexperts Opinion left a favourable impression when winning over hurdles last month and looks the type to do better over fences, a view that also applies to Court In A Storm (second choice) who looks sure to win in this sphere but the forecast rain is a concern. RICKETY BRIDGE (nap) is 2-2 since switched to fences and the 4lb rise for his latest C&D win may not be enough to stop him following up. Topweight La Pinsonniere is certainly not out of this.
